Three environments exist: sandbox, staging, and production. Sandbox rebuilds on every push and tolerates broken links; staging mirrors production's cache topology and is the only safe place to test invalidation rules. Production rebuilds are triggered solely by content-change webhooks, never by schedule, to keep the diff-based rebuild graph deterministic. Each environment reads its settings from a mounted config volume. The production environment currently runs with the following configuration values.

settings of tagef-bawif:
DRUIX_HOST=druix.zemvarlabs.internal
DRUIX_PORT=8000

## Warranty Costs — Managers Only

Quick flag for department heads: warranty claims on the Torvex G4 compressor line are running 38% over budget this year. Most failures trace back to the seal batch from the Olmsbridge supplier swap. Dana Ferrick's team is negotiating recovery, but don't expect full reimbursement. We're pausing the extended-warranty promo until the fix ships. Keep this off customer-facing channels for now. The plan going forward is noted just below.

confidential, yagep-kagef: Rusvanox Holdings is in early talks to buy Julwynix Systems for about $454.5 million. The Fenael launch date is April 23, and nothing goes to the press before then. Legal wants the Druwynix Works term sheet redrafted before January 8.

## On-call: ThumbForge queue

ThumbForge consumes upload events and renders thumbnails in three sizes. If the queue backs up past 5k items, scale workers via the Hatchery dashboard. Failed renders retry twice, then land in the dead-letter bin reviewed each morning. Workers won't start without a complete env file; the final entry is the queue access secret, which goes immediately below this line:

sealed setting: ARCHIVE_KEY3=8d0

Minutes – Regional Sales Review, Orvaine Holdings

Present: K. Delmas (chair), F. Arnoux, S. Pellwright.

The Westmere region delivered 103% of target, supported by strong uptake of the Solvane product suite. Easthaven underperformed at 89%, attributed to delayed onboarding of two distributors. Arnoux will prepare a corrective plan within ten days. Department heads are asked to review staffing alignment carefully. The confidential note on business plans follows immediately below.

board note of kaguf-hagug: Only 36 of the 386 pilot accounts renewed Julax, so a churn review is set for August 11. Fravanox Partners is in early talks to buy Jorirek Group for about $450.0 million.